Human gut microbiota interactions shape the long-term growth dynamics and evolutionary adaptations of <i>Clostridioides difficile</i>
2024-07-17
Abstract excerpt
<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Clostridioides difficile can transiently or persistently colonize the human gut, posing a risk factor for infections. This colonization is influenced by complex molecular and ecological interactions with human gut microbiota. By investigating C. difficile dynamics in human gut communities over hundreds of generations, we show patterns of stable coexistence, instability, or competitive exclusion...
